Energy Generation Opportunities
As societies shift in the direction of lasting methods, discovering power generation chances within wastewater systems has actually come to be increasingly essential. Wastewater treatment procedures can be taken advantage of to generate renewable power, which not just helps in reducing functional expenses yet additionally adds to the overall sustainability of city facilities.One popular approach is anaerobic digestion, where microbes break down organic issue in the absence of oxygen, producing biogas (Wastewater System). This biogas, mainly made up of methane, can be made use of to generate power and heat, providing a significant energy source for wastewater treatment facilities. Furthermore, excess biogas can be updated to biomethane, which can be infused right into natural gas grids or made use of as a vehicle fuel
One more appealing opportunity is the extraction of energy from thermal gradients in wastewater via technologies such as heat exchangers. This procedure allows centers to record and utilize the warmth generated during wastewater treatment, better improving energy effectiveness.
Implementing these energy generation methods not just advertises power self-sufficiency within wastewater systems yet additionally aligns with global objectives of reducing greenhouse gas emissions and cultivating a circular economic climate. Thus, integrating power generation right into wastewater monitoring is a necessary advance in contemporary facilities growth.
